What they do

An English or Language Arts Teacher teaches English in elementary to secondary schools. Focuses on English, writing, composition, literature, and critical analysis. In elementary school, language arts classes focus on basic reading, writing and linguistic / communication skills. In middle school, the English curriculum evolves and expands to include more complicated reading comprehension, such as fiction, poetry and essays. In teaching high school, the focus relies on developing analytical skills.
